Yes, but there are many reasons not to do that.
The most important is site performance will suffer. Encryption slows everything down - the web server has to encrypt everything and the browser has to decrypt everything. This includes page images, etc.
The second reason is bandwidth - encryption adds alot of overhead to HTTP traffic.
The first time a spider crawls your site, you'll notice it.
If there are specific pages on your site that you would like HTTPS, I can post instructions on how to accomplish it. But I wouldn't recommend the entire site be made SSL unless you are prepared for the performance and bandwidth hits you will take.
